#841ef5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#841ef5 is composed of 51.8% red, 11.8%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.1% cyan, 87.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 268.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.5% and a lightness of 53.9%. #841ef5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3cff with #0900eb.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

Shades and Tints of #841ef5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f5edf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#841ef5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898192 is the less saturated color, while #8415fe is the most saturated one.
